About

Yoichi Seto is a scholar working on Surgery, Information Systems and Signal Processing. According to data from OpenAlex, Yoichi Seto has authored 31 papers receiving a total of 342 indexed citations (citations by other indexed papers that have themselves been cited), including 15 papers in Surgery, 7 papers in Information Systems and 7 papers in Signal Processing. Recurrent topics in Yoichi Seto's work include Hip disorders and treatments (13 papers), Orthopaedic implants and arthroplasty (8 papers) and Biometric Identification and Security (7 papers). Yoichi Seto is often cited by papers focused on Hip disorders and treatments (13 papers), Orthopaedic implants and arthroplasty (8 papers) and Biometric Identification and Security (7 papers). Yoichi Seto collaborates with scholars based in Japan. Yoichi Seto's co-authors include Shigeo Suzuki, Yoshitaka Kasahara, Noboru Ikeda, Takashi Nakamura, Shuichi Ishida, Kenta Takahashi, Shogo Mukai, Yosuke Kasai, Yoshinori Kikuchi and Koji Hasegawa and has published in prestigious journals such as Arthroscopy The Journal of Arthroscopic and Related Surgery, Journal of Pediatric Orthopaedics and Optical and Quantum Electronics.
